dc.description.abstractThis article highlights the main theoretical and practical issues of calculating general erosion processes in cohesive soil channels. The dynamics of flow saturation with particles and its dependence on flow velocity, sediment concentration, and the physical properties of the soil are studied. Integral consideration of parameters such as flow, topography, geology, and other channelforming factors is included. The separation of soil under the influence of turbulent flow and the empirical relationships of this process are described. As a result of the research, mathematical models and calculation methodologies for assessing erosion processes in cohesive soils are proposed. The calculation of the free surface curve was carried out using nomograms based on the Hydoproject methodology. Hydraulic parameters of the channel were determined, and its profile was reconstructed based on this methodology.en_US
